My wife and I were looking for some wings or a good burger and this place nailed it. Wings were big, tender and moist. She had lemon pepper and I had the sweet red chili. Both were flavorful and properly balanced. I had a single patty burger with lettuce, tomato, mayo and cheese. Again, very nicely done. The patty was cooked perfectly. Cheese had nice flavor (real cheese) and the veggies were fresh. My wife had fries. Well salted, properly cooked and good flavor. We both had sodas as well. With tax and a 15% tip it was right at $40.00. In today's economy, we felt that was very reasonable compared to so many similar places. We would not have been able to eat that much at a fast food place for the same or lower price. Prices were better than chain fast food places with better portions. My burger was $6.00. The wings were $8.99 for 8 wings. Any other place near where I live are charging $1.50 or more per wing. They are smaller, and the sauces not nearly as well prepared. This is true of the many places I have tried that have "Wing" in their names. You order at a counter, food is brought to the table. It came out quickly and was hot. The atmosphere is very casual.
